Children of Zandspruit revel in sports tournament

ZANDSPRUIT – Impophomo hosts its 10th annual sports tournament at Emthonjeni Community Centre.

A football and netball tournament gets children of Zandspruit off the streets and on the field for a day of community upliftment.

John-Mark Kilian, director of Impophomo , a non-profit organisation focused on the upliftment of Zandspruit, said this sports tournament was in aid of youth development within the community. The tournament, which is now in its 10th year, was held at Emthonjeni Community Centre on 10 June.

Kilian said they had been working with community leaders to keep children off the streets and away from drugs and joining gangs. “In-between events we work with the youth where we do sports clinics like football and netball and we hoping to introduce cricket, rugby and even golf,” added Kilian.

Impophomo is an organsiation started by Northpoint City Church and Umsizi , a company focused on the implementation of socio-economic development programmes primarily in rural communities.

The day brought out the best in these young sports enthusiasts who were joined by 57 Americans from Texas who had come to the country hold various outreach programmes around the city, but more specifically for Zandspruit.

Kilian added that people tended to forget about the residents from Zandspruit, “On the other side of the valley there are all the people who have something, but on this side of the valley, are those caught on the poverty side.”

He said for the past nine years Impophomo had been in the community to try and help the close to 80 000 people who called Zandspruit home. He also explained the meaning of the word Zandspruit, which means land with no water, while Impophomo translates to rushing waters.
